Belahia Population - Muzaffarpur, Bihar
Belahia is a medium size village located in Kurhani Block of Muzaffarpur district, Bihar with total 112 families residing. The Belahia village has population of 498 of which 273 are males while 225 are females as per Population Census 2011.In Belahia village population of children with age 0-6 is 82 which makes up 16.47 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Belahia village is 824 which is lower than Bihar state average of 918. Child Sex Ratio for the Belahia as per census is 1050, higher than Bihar average of 935.
Belahia village has lower literacy rate compared to Bihar. In 2011, literacy rate of Belahia village was 50.24 % compared to 61.80 % of Bihar. In Belahia Male literacy stands at 53.65 % while female literacy rate was 45.90 %.

Belahia Data
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total No. of Houses | 112 | - | - |
Population | 498 | 273 | 225 |
Child (0-6) | 82 | 40 | 42 |
Schedule Caste | 0 | 0 | 0 |
Schedule Tribe | 0 | 0 | 0 |
Literacy | 50.24 % | 53.65 % | 45.90 % |
Total Workers | 161 | 152 | 9 |
Main Worker | 5 | - | - |
Marginal Worker | 156 | 147 | 9 |
